These diagrams are standardized to a certain extent, but variations can exist. Typically, a 2011 Ford F250 will utilize a 7-way RV blade-style connector, which is the most common type for heavy-duty trucks like yours. This connector is designed to provide power for a comprehensive range of trailer functions. Here's a general breakdown of what you'll find:

  • Running Lights
  • Left Turn Signal
  • Right Turn Signal
  • Brake Lights
  • Ground
  • Trailer Brake Control (if equipped)
  • Reverse Lights (optional, but often present)

Knowing the specific pinout for your 2011 Ford F250 is essential for troubleshooting. For instance, if your trailer's turn signals aren't working, you can use the diagram to identify the turn signal wire on your truck's connector and then trace it to the trailer's corresponding wire. A common wiring configuration for a 7-way connector might look like this:

Pin Position Function
1 (1 o'clock) Ground
2 (11 o'clock) Left Turn/Stop
3 (9 o'clock) Tail/Running Lights
4 (7 o'clock) 12V+ Battery Power
5 (5 o'clock) Electric/Surge Trailer Brakes
6 (3 o'clock) Right Turn/Stop
7 (center) Reverse Lights / Auxiliary Power

When you're faced with a trailer wiring issue, the 2011 Ford F250 Trailer Plug Wiring Diagram becomes your best friend. It allows you to systematically test each function. You can use a multimeter to check for voltage at each pin when the corresponding function is activated on your truck. For example, to check the running lights, you would turn on your truck's headlights and then check for voltage at the pin designated for running lights on the connector. This methodical approach, guided by the diagram, is the most effective way to diagnose and fix any wiring problems.
